FAISALABAD: PML-N leader and parliamentary secretary in National Assembly Rajab Ali Khan Baloch passed away Sunday after protracted illness.
He was suffering from cancer and was under treatment at a private hospital of Lahore, where he died.
Funeral prayers of the deceased would be held at his ancestral village Chak no. 455 GB Kanjwani tehsil Tandlianwala of Faisalabad.
Rajab Ali Khan Baloch was elected MNA twice from NA-78 and NA-103.
The PML-N central and provincial leadership expressing grief over the death of party leader prayed for the departed soul to rest in eternal peace and courage for the bereaved family to bear this irreparable loss with equanimity.
